Lithium Americas Corp. Overview
Pro stress-test →Lithium Americas Corp. focuses on developing, building, and operating lithium deposits and chemical processing facilities in the United States and Canada, with its flagship asset being the Thacker Pass project in northern Nevada—the largest known lithium resource in the U.S. The company was formed in October 2023 following a separation from the former Lithium Americas Corp., positioning it as a pure-play U.S. lithium developer critical to domestic supply chain security.
Strategic Profile
Pro stress-test →Lithium Americas is uniquely positioned as the leading domestic lithium producer focused on U.S. onshoring, benefiting from government support and Trump administration initiatives to reduce reliance on foreign mineral suppliers. The Thacker Pass project has secured a DOE loan and represents a key national security asset amid growing demand for critical minerals in EV and battery production.
Competitive Landscape
Pro stress-test →Lithium Americas competes with established lithium producers like Albemarle (ALB) and Rio Tinto (RIO), but differentiates through its focus on U.S. domestic production and access to the largest American lithium resource. Direct competitors include Standard Lithium Ltd., American Lithium Corp., and Canada Nickel Company Inc. in the North American lithium space.
